Data erasure is the process of securely and permanently deleting data from a storage device such as a hard drive, solid-state drive, or any other type of digital storage media. The goal of data erasure is to ensure that the deleted data cannot be recovered or accessed by unauthorized users.
The DoD 5220.22-M wiping method consists of three passes: Pass 1: Overwrite the hard drive with zeros. Pass 2: Overwrite the hard drive with ones. Pass 3: Overwrite the hard drive with random data.
